Kindergarten should be fun. And teaching kindergarten can be fun too. But as any good kindergarten teacher would well understand, it can be an extremely active experience. A kindergarten teacher has to get fully involved and involve children with lots of interesting kindergarten activities, worksheets and exercises, that would hold their attention and make it an enjoyable experience for them.
